Transaction 0177063df175340dfca9bb9304e355a295010ba7a1370a98f13c003a81254649
1 Input
1 Output
-
0177063df175340dfca9bb9304e355a295010ba7a1370a98f13c003a81254649:0
- value
- 37399445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98a4fda289345e707f063cca361b0b4c895c8ba6 OP_EQUAL
- address
- MMpGbM7BuEcVDb9UkKn3NEf8JNdN2wJn1H